L-aspartate transaminase, also known as aspartate aminotransferase (AST), is an enzyme that plays a crucial role in amino acid metabolism. It catalyzes the reversible transfer of an α-amino group between L-aspartate and α-ketoglutarate, resulting in the formation of oxaloacetate and L-glutamate. This reaction is essential for the interconversion of amino acids and for linking amino acid metabolism with the citric acid cycle. AST levels are commonly measured via blood tests to assess liver health or diagnose liver damage. Elevated AST can indicate liver injury or disease, or muscle damage.
